Page 17 of 46 Leaded varistors B722* StandarD series Reliability data Test Test methods/conditions Requirement Varistor voltage The voltage between two terminals with To meet the specified value the specified measuring current applied is called VV (1 mADC @ 0.2 ... 2 s). Clamping voltage The maximum voltage between two terminals with the specified standard impulse current (8/20 s) applied. To meet the specified value Endurance at upper category temperature 1000 h at UCT |V/V (1 mA)| 10% Surge current derating, 8/20 s 10 surge currents (8/20 s), unipolar, interval 30 s, amplitude corresponding to derating curve for 10 impulses at 20 s Surge current derating, 2 ms 10 surge currents (2 ms), unipolar, |V/V (1 mA)| 10% interval 120 s, amplitude corresponding (measured in direction of to derating curve for 10 impulses at surge current) 2 ms No visible damage Electric strength IEC 61051-1, test 4.9.2 After having continuously applied the maximum allowable AC voltage at UCT 2 C for 1000 h, the specimen shall be stored at room temperature and normal humidity for 1 to 2 h. Thereafter, the change of VV shall be measured. Metal balls method, 2500 VRMS, 60 s The varistor is placed in a container holding 1.6 0.2 mm diameter metal balls such that only the terminations of the varistor are protruding. The specified voltage shall be applied between both terminals of the specimen connected together and the electrode inserted between the metal balls. Page 42 of 46 Leaded varistors B722* StandarD series Cautions and warnings General 1. EPCOS metal oxide varistors are designed for specific applications and should not be used for purposes not identified in our specifications, application notes and data books unless otherwise agreed with EPCOS during the design-in-phase. 2. Ensure suitability of SIOVs through reliability testing during the design-in phase. SIOVs should be evaluated taking into consideration worst-case conditions. 3. For applications of SIOVs in line-to-ground circuits based on various international and local standards there are restrictions existing or additional safety measures required. Storage 1. Store SIOVs only in original packaging. Do not open the package before storage. 2. Storage conditions in original packaging: Storage temperature: 25 C ... +45 C, Relative humidity: <75% annual average, <95% on maximum 30 days a year. Dew precipitation: is to be avoided. 3. Avoid contamination of an SIOV's during storage, handling and processing. 4. Avoid storage of SIOVs in harmful environments that can affect the function during long-term operation (examples given under operation precautions). 5. The SIOV type series should be soldered within the time specified: SIOV-S, -Q, -LS, -B, -SFS 24 months ETFV 12 months. Handling 1. SIOVs must not be dropped. 2. Components must not be touched with bare hands. Gloves are recommended. 3. Avoid contamination of the surface of SIOV electrodes during handling, be careful of the sharp edge of SIOV electrodes. Soldering (where applicable) 1. Use rosin-type flux or non-activated flux. 2. Insufficient preheating may cause ceramic cracks. 3. Rapid cooling by dipping in solvent is not recommended. 4. Complete removal of flux is recommended. Please read Cautions and warnings and Important notes at the end of this document. Page 43 of 46 Leaded varistors B722* StandarD series Mounting 1. Potting, sealing or adhesive compounds can produce chemical reactions in the SIOV ceramic that will degrade the component's electrical characteristics. 2. Overloading SIOVs may result in ruptured packages and expulsion of hot materials. For this reason SIOVs should be physically shielded from adjacent components. Operation 1. Use SIOVs only within the specified temperature operating range. 2. Use SIOVs only within the specified voltage and current ranges. 3. Environmental conditions must not harm SIOVs. Use SIOVs only in normal atmospheric conditions. Avoid use in deoxidizing gases (chlorine gas, hydrogen sulfide gas, ammonia gas, sulfuric acid gas etc), corrosive agents, humid or salty conditions.Contact with any liquids and solvents should be prevented.
